Tribunal's reasoningAt the remote public hearing on 21 November 2024, Tribunal Judge Plowright sitting alone dismissed Mr D Tissera's claims for wrongful dismissal and holiday pay against Smilepod Limited. The claimant appeared in person and the respondent was represented by counsel.
The judgment records that Smilepod Limited's counterclaim for breach of contract was dismissed upon withdrawal. No monetary award is recorded in the judgment.
